    Note: Thomas, son of Robert Wilson:

    Mecklenburg Co. Deed Bk. 16 page 100, 8 Nov 1797. Thomas Wilson to JamesGreer for 480 Silver Dollars, 1160 A adj other lands of the grantee beingpart of a grant to Zaccheus Wilson, 25 Apr 1767, conveyed to RobertWilson 7 Jan 1775 & willed by the sd. Robert to his son the grantor.Wit: Zach. Wilson and Robt. Bigham. Proven July Session 1798
    The 1820 census of Williamson County, TN indicates there were at leastnine children in this family.
    Thomas Wilson, Williamson Co. p. 57 210201-13010
    Charts complied by Joe Cobb, Nashville, TN show nine children.
    Williamson Co. Will Bk. 3, page 271
    THOMAS WILSON, deceased inventory, October Session 1821. Presented byPeggy Wilson and A.A. Wilson. Household goods, farming tools, animals,four negroes, (long list) etc., plus 217 acres land lying in WilliamsonCo. on Harpeth Lick, 500 acres in Bedford County on Cany Spring Creek.Signed Margaret Wilson, A.A.     Williamson Co. Will Bk. 2-377
    W. R. Nunn, John Guy and William Logan allotted years provisions toMARGARET WILSON, widow of Thomas Wilson, dec. Margaret Wilson and AaronA. Wilson, administrators.

    July Term, 1826 Thomas Wilson, settlement with Margaret Wilson and Aaron A. Wilson, admin. Sale October 25, 1821, sale November 8, 1822, Negro sale, rent of plantation on Caney Spring Creek 1823, 1824, 1825, hire four negroes 1822.
    Williamson Co. Will Bk. 4, page 321, inventory of sales presented April Session, 1828, administrator Samuel Scales. Richard C. Hancock was appointed guardian of three minor children (Samuel, Thomas & Matilda Wilson) in January 1831.
